I have been waiting from really long time, to make this video, I mean, this video is all about the way, how you should put the RAM sticks, in your mother board.

Actually the message I tried to convey here is, let's understand the same with an example, like if you decided to put 16 GB RAM in your PC, or whichever RAM you decided to have, just divide it into two RAM sticks (being completely identical), and then you should put it in your motherboard.

The reason behind this is, the identical RAM sticks would run in dual channel configuration, which way better than having a single channel memory.
Your system gets to be more responsive, much faster; you'd be able to see the difference in boot times, or app load times, plus there's jump in FPS (5-10) as well. So, if you're getting much better performance, for free (buying two 8 GB sticks instead of buying one 16 GB won't cost you anything extra),
why you shouldn't take the advantage of so.
